Abstract
To determine whether the incidence of canine leishmaniasis has increased on Crete, Greece, we fitted infection models to serodiagnostic records of 8,848 dog samples for 1990-2006. Models predicted that seroprevalence has increased 2.4% (95% confidence interval 1.61%-3.51%) per year and that incidence has increased 2.2- to 3.8-fold over this 17-year period.Entities:

Variation in incidence over time estimated from cross-sectional data for 1,205 dogs with accompanying demographic records, Crete, Greece, 1990–2006*
| Period | Model 1 | Model 2 | No. dogs | |||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Incidence/mo | 95% CI | Loss of infection/mo | 95% CI | Incidence/mo | 95% CI | |||
| 1999–2000 | 0.016 | 0.0107–0.0206 | 0.045 | 0.0260–0.0645 | 0.015 | 0.0093–0.0213 | 237 | |
| 2001–2002 | 0.029 | 0.0114–0.0455 | 0.071 | 0.0201–0.1211 | 0.023 | 0.0166–0.0298 | 219 | |
| 2003–2004 | 0.030 | 0.0216–0.0381 | 0.049 | 0.0320–0.0667 | 0.029 | 0.0221–0.0367 | 401 | |
| 2005–2006 | 0.059 | 0.0233–0.0946 | 0.106 | 0.0383–0.17430 | 0.032 | 0.0205–0.0477 | 348 | |
*Only model 1 is designed to estimate loss of infection (serorecovery). CI, confidence interval. A full description of these models is available in the Technical Appendix.
Variation in incidence over time estimated from longitudinal data for 179 dogs with accompanying demographic records, Crete, Greece, 1990–2006*
| Period | Model 3 |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| No positive/ no. tested | Incidence/ mo | 95% CI | |
| 1999–2000 | 6/56 | 0.014 | 0.0061–0.0280 |
| 2001–2002 | 7/30 | 0.033 | 0.0153–0.0612 |
| 2003–2004 | 12/56 | 0.030 | 0.0172–0.0490 |
| 2005–2006 | 10/37 | 0.039 | 0.0210–0.0670 |
*CI, confidence interval. A full description of this model is available in the Technical Appendix.
FigureAnnual seroprevalence of zoonotic visceral leishmaniasis in dogs on Crete, Greece, 1990–2006. Shown are logistic fits of age-adjusted prevalences (line and squares) for dogs from 97 villages (indirect immunofluoresecent antibody test [IFAT] cutoff titer 160) and crude seroprevalences (line and triangles) calculated from records of the Veterinary Laboratory of Heraklion, Crete, Hellenic Ministry of Rural Development and Food (www.minagric.gr) (IFAT cutoff titer 200). Binomial standard error bars are shown.
